Common problems addressed by broken solar panel repair include cracked or shattered glass, damaged wiring, malfunctioning cells, and loose or broken mounting components. These issues can lead to decreased energy output, hotspots, or electrical faults that may affect the entire system. Repair services often involve replacing broken glass, re-securing loose parts, repairing damaged wiring, or replacing damaged cells. Addressing these problems promptly can prevent more extensive repairs in the future and help maintain the longevity of the solar installation.

The overview below groups typical Broken Solar Panel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Montclair, NJ.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or fixes like replacing broken panels or addressing wiring issues generally range from $250 to $600. Many routine repairs fall within this middle band, depending on the extent of the damage.
Moderate Repairs - More involved repairs, such as replacing multiple panels or fixing inverter problems, often cost between $600 and $2,000. These projects are common for systems that need significant component replacements or upgrades.
Large-Scale Repairs - Extensive repairs involving structural issues or major system overhauls can range from $2,000 to $5,000 or more. Such projects are less frequent but necessary for older or heavily damaged systems.
Full System Replacement - Replacing an entire solar panel array typically costs between $10,000 and $30,000, depending on system size and complexity. Larger, more complex projects can reach higher costs, but most replacements fall within this range.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es solar panels to break? Solar panels can break due to weather-related damage, debris impact, or age-related wear and tear, which may require professional repair services.
How can I tell if my solar panel is damaged? Signs of damage include decreased energy production, visible cracks, or corrosion; a local contractor can assess the condition of your panels.
Are broken solar panels safe to handle? Handling or inspecting broken panels should be left to experienced service providers to avoid safety hazards and ensure proper repairs.
What types of repairs do solar panels typically need? Repairs may involve replacing damaged cells, fixing wiring issues, or sealing cracks to restore optimal performance.
How do local contractors diagnose broken solar panels? They perform on-site inspections, visual assessments, and electrical testing to determine the extent of damage and necessary repairs.
